\textit{R. Janssen} [Parallel Comput. 4, 211-213 (1987; Zbl 0641.68070)] proposed an algorithm for which the use of \(n\) processors can reduce computer time by more than a factor of \(n\). It is shown that in the example that Janssen offered the superlinear speedup was possible only due to inefficient programming of the algorithm on a single processor. Yet Janssen's claim is correct, as shown by another example.
